Mental Health Town Hall explores why loneliness and isolation are increasing, how they affect individuals and society, and what we can do to rebuild connection and belonging in families, workplaces, schools, and communities. Groundbreaking research shows that chronic loneliness and social isolation can be as harmful to health as smoking 15 cigarettes a day and significantly increase the risk of early death. Loneliness is now recognized as one of the most urgent public health challenges of our time, affecting mental health, physical health, and overall well-being across all ages and communities.

Dr. Julianne Holt Lunstad - We are honored to welcome Dr. Holt Lunstad as our keynote speaker. She is one of the world's leading scientific authorities on loneliness, social connection, and health. Her research helped establish loneliness and social isolation as serious risk factors for early mortality and reshaped how public health systems worldwide understand the importance of human connection. She served as the lead scientific editor for the U.S. Surgeon General's Advisory and National Strategy on Social Connection, has advised organizations including the World Health Organization, the CDC, and the National Academy of Sciences, and has provided expert testimony to the U.S. Congress. Her work continues to influence policy, healthcare, and community strategies around the globe.
